The Library Socialism “Communist Manifesto” PDF “Socialism Seriously” PDF “Class Struggle Unionism" PDF NEPA Defense Bloc “ending violence quickly" pdf "cheap shots, ambushes, and other lessons" pdfXXXXXX “Joyful Militancy" "Mutual Aid" PDF general section “Practicing new worlds” "Street Rebellion” “Let this book radicalize you” “Freedom is a constant struggle” "Operating system, anarchist theory of the modern state” “Manufacturing Consent” pdf Black Activism “Black Antifascist Tradition" “How we get free” Migrant Justice “unbuild walls” Palestine Solidarity “palestine in the world on fire” "Palestine, a solcialist intro” XXXXXXXXX